Grant Recipients
The Sustainable Communities Grant program, a partnership between Northwestern's Office of Neighborhood and Community Relations, ULRI, and ULSE, supports grassroots environmental stewardship and community engagement through grants awarded to local nonprofits annually.
Grant recipients are community-based organizations that work to advance innovative, community-driven solutions to environmental and sustainability challenges. These projects address key priorities such as environmental resilience, climate action, and equitable access to healthy, sustainable resources.
